Output 17516a2f1e39cb9dbf76328606da53008cc105cdc59626b1184bdc3e2a2fefde:0

value
19700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 920ee7dfb48a1b1fdcf0c506591d929b5eff1ca7 OP_EQUAL
address
3F1JSDnFGkuNrwdZtD9As32T7nVobWZMNz
transaction
17516a2f1e39cb9dbf76328606da53008cc105cdc59626b1184bdc3e2a2fefde
confirmations
228159
spent
true